Poor Man's Turtles

1 (1.7 oz.) Package Rolo Candy
8 Mini Pretzels
8 Pecan Halves

Preheat oven to 325 degrees. Place pretzels on a foil lined cookie sheet. Place 1 Rolo on top of each pretzel. Bake for approx. 4 minutes or until chocolate gets shiny. Remove from oven and gently press 1 pecan half into each treat. Cool for 10 minutes, then place sheet in the fridge to set.

Note: You can make more or less of these. I just make 8 at a time because that's how many Rolo's come in a package and this way I won't eat too many. At Christmas time I buy the individual Rolo's that you can find in the Christmas candy and make about 100 of them.

Serves: 8
Per Serving: 42 Calories; 2g Fat (52.5% calories from fat); trace Protein; 5g Carbohydrate; trace Dietary Fiber; 1mg Cholesterol; 12mg Sodium. Exchanges: 0 Grain (Starch); 0 Lean Meat; 0 Fat. WWP: 1 (www.AimeesAdventures.com)
